Analysis of Graphite/Polyimide Rail Shear Specimens Subjected to Mechanical and Thermal Loading.
Abstract
This report discusses the results of a two-dimensional, linear-elastic, finite element analysis of selected graphite/polyimide rail shear test specimens. The study includes the analysis of mechanical loading and the effect of heating the specimen to a uniform temperature. The presence of specimen free edges and their influence on the accuracy of the rail shear test is discussed. Parameters in this analysis include the length-to-width ratio of the specimen and the ply layup for symmetric, balanced laminates. Results presented include shear and normal stress distributions and the deflection behavior of various specimens caused by the mechanical loading and elevated temperature. (MM)
